Output 0351ea5717d19c8deded92ff36ceeac3f56b486da7c0af2f516ba5a68a1cec6b:0

value
13245894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753a61db8d99316951cf4103dcc50f522d27ab43 OP_EQUAL
address
MJb1ELwbtkFuGBZBtBu7zdXVRLzSGFJEkd
transaction
0351ea5717d19c8deded92ff36ceeac3f56b486da7c0af2f516ba5a68a1cec6b
spent
true